Time to Make Plans for New Year's Eve

Joseph Coupal - Wednesday, December 28, 2011

Try out First Night Raleigh 2012. The New Year's Eve celebration, First Night Raleigh 2012 is celebrating its 21st year. This year’s First Night Raleigh festival takes on a French-inspired theme.  Many of the celebration’s dozens of performances and activities have been designed to reflect French influences. Forget about spending New Year’s Eve in your apartment in Raleigh, NC; head to downtown Raleigh for a fun-filled event. "All Day Passes" are on sale now.

The 21st annual New Year’s Eve arts festival will take place on Saturday, December 31, 2011, in a 20+ block area of downtown Raleigh.  The festivities start with a children's celebration at the state history and natural science museums. Kids can participate in hands-on crafts creating impressionist paintings, making miniature sailboats and decorating their own versions of the Eiffel Tower. "The Owl Tree," an interactive sculpture, encourages you to make a wish for the coming year. There will also be circus performers, storytellers, giant puppets and more. A mini French film festival will take place inside the N.C. Museum of Natural Sciences. There will be a screening of "Madeline" at 4:30 p.m.

The biggest plan for it is a 90-foot Ferris wheel, which festival organizers are calling La Grand Roue de Raleigh, like La Grand Roue de Paris, the large Ferris wheel in Paris.

The People's Procession takes the party from the museums to Fayetteville Street for an early countdown at 7 p.m. with live music, fireworks and the descent of the Raleigh Acorn. There's a countdown, acorn drop and fireworks at midnight too.

Holiday Groceries Needed for the Raleigh Community

Joseph Coupal - Monday, December 19, 2011

Auston Grove Apartments, an community of apartments in Raleigh, is asking our residents for community help this holiday season.
 
Along with the Gobbles to Go meal deliveries this Christmas Eve, the other goal of the Raleigh Rescue Mission is to have each meal recipient receive a bag of groceries to enjoy over the holiday weekend with their family.  Those Gobbles to Go meal recipients who are Meals on Wheels clients will not receive their normal meal deliveries over the weekend and The Raleigh Rescue Mission wants to give them and all of the Gobbles to Go meal recipients some extra groceries to get them through the holidays.

The Raleigh Rescue Mission is still in need of 200 Holiday Groceries to Go bags in order to have enough for all of our Gobbles to Go meal recipients.  Auston Grove Apartments would like you to know that besides groceries, they also need hams, cranberry sauce, apple juice and chicken broth for our Gobbles to Go meals.  Please bring Holiday Groceries to Go bags to Raleigh Rescue Mission at 314 E. Hargett Street by Friday, December 23.

Raleigh Winterfest

Joseph Coupal - Tuesday, December 13, 2011

Grab your mittens and scarves from your apartment in Raleigh and make your way to the center city for Raleigh's favorite holiday event, the Raleigh Winterfest. Winterfest is an outdoor extravaganza featuring an outdoor skating rink with natural ice. If you haven’t been there yet, head over to this  family-friendly celebration of fun-filled activities.

What will you find there? An outdoor ice rink, Choirs, bands, local entertainers, Santa Claus, sledding ramps, ice carving demonstrations, carriage and carousel rides and more!

Here is the weekly schedule:
Sledding Sundays: SnowMyYard.com will create a winter wonderland on December 18, January 8 and January 15.

Two for Tuesdays: Skaters will receive one free admission to the rink with the purchase of one paid admission (includes skate rental).

Stroller Skate Thursday Mornings: Parents and babies share outdoor fun! Skate and push a strollers on the ice from 10 am-11 am. Click here to read an article and watch a video about stroller skating!

Date & Skate Thursdays: Free carriage rides with skating wristband from 6 pm-9 pm.

Rock Around the Rink Fridays (select dates TBA): DJ Paradime from Pulse 102 will rock the rink from 6 pm-10 pm.

The Choice Between Renting and Owning

Joseph Coupal - Monday, December 05, 2011

The housing market is stagnating right now and real estate brokers would have potential buyers believe that there is no better time than the present to buy a home. It is true, prices are down and mortgage rates are at all-time lows.

Unfortunately for the real estate brokers, many clients are not persuaded by that logic. Instead, in increasing numbers, they are choosing to rent instead of buy — unconvinced that the housing market has yet hit bottom. Would be buyers also understand that unless you plan to stay in your home for more than 10 years, buying a home may not be the right investment for everyone.

With apartments in Raleigh, NC that are conveniently located near downtown and offering apartment amenities that can’t be found in homes; renting is a great option for many. There is also a broad mix of tenants in the Auston Grove Apartment community: young single residents and families and empty-nesters that no longer have homeownership on their wish list.
